That\u2019s why regular maintenance is non-negotiable\u2014and turns ratio testing is a key part of that process.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">What is a Turns Ratio Tester?<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>A <strong>transformer turns ratio tester<\/strong> is a specialized device that measures the turns ratio of a transformer. The turns ratio is the ratio of the number of turns in the primary winding to the number of turns in the secondary winding. This ratio determines how the transformer adjusts voltage: for example, a 10:1 turns ratio means the transformer steps down the voltage to one-tenth of its input value.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In simple terms, the turns ratio tester checks whether the transformer is transforming voltage correctly. If the measured ratio doesn\u2019t match the expected value, it could indicate problems like shorted turns, open circuits, or other faults that need attention.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Why Turns Ratio Testing is Essential for Maintenance<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Turns ratio testing is a critical part of distribution transformer maintenance for several reasons: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Early Fault Detection<\/strong>: By measuring the turns ratio, technicians can spot issues like shorted turns or incorrect tap settings before they lead to bigger problems.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Performance Verification<\/strong>: Regular testing ensures the transformer is operating efficiently and within its design specifications.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Preventive Maintenance<\/strong>: Catching issues early helps avoid unexpected failures, reducing downtime and repair costs.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Safety Assurance<\/strong>: Faulty transformers can pose safety risks, such as electrical fires or equipment damage. Testing helps mitigate these risks.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>In short, turns ratio testing is a proactive way to keep distribution transformers in top shape and ensure reliable power delivery.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">How to Use a Turns Ratio Tester for Maintenance<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Using a turns ratio tester for distribution transformer maintenance involves a few straightforward steps. Here\u2019s a simplified overview of the process: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Prepare the Transformer<\/strong>: Before testing, the transformer must be de-energized and isolated from the power grid to ensure safety.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Connect the Tester<\/strong>: Attach the tester\u2019s leads to the primary and secondary windings of the transformer. Make sure the connections are secure and correctly aligned.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Perform the Test<\/strong>: Apply a known voltage to the primary winding using the tester and measure the induced voltage in the secondary winding. The tester will calculate the turns ratio based on these voltages.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Record and Interpret Results<\/strong>: Compare the measured turns ratio to the transformer\u2019s specified ratio. If the results are within an acceptable tolerance (usually \u00b10.5%), the transformer is functioning properly. If not, further investigation is needed.<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Pro Tip<\/strong>: Always follow the manufacturer\u2019s instructions for your specific turns ratio tester, as different models may have unique features or requirements.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Types of Turns Ratio Testers<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>There are two main types of turns ratio testers to choose from, each with its own advantages: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Manual Testers<\/strong>: These require the user to adjust settings and calculate the ratio manually.
